Exactly How to Make Bone Broth in your home
Making bone broth in the house is a straightforward process that requires just a few vital active ingredients and some persistence. To start, one requires bones, ideally from grass-fed or natural sources, together with water, vinegar, and optional vegetables and natural herbs for this page included taste. The bones ought to be roasted very first to boost the broth's splendor.
In a large pot or slow cooker, the baked bones are incorporated with water and a sprinkle of vinegar, which aids essence minerals. The mix is given a boil and after that simmered for an extensive duration, commonly 12 to 2 days, to permit the nutrients to permeate into the fluid.
During this time, any kind of scum that increases to the surface can be skimmed off. As soon as completed, the broth is strained to eliminate solids, and it can be stored in containers or containers. Bone broth can be cooled or frozen for future use.

How Much Time Can Bone Broth Be Kept in the Refrigerator or Freezer?
Bone broth can be saved in the refrigerator for about 4 to 5 days. If icy, it lasts significantly much longer, typically as much as 6 months, preserving its dietary value and flavor when effectively secured.
